Mapleton Conservation Area

Mapleton is a mid-sized conservation area in England, covering approximately 76.6 hectares of protected landscape. It is designated in 1981, reflecting the area's longstanding cultural and architectural significance. The area includes 8 listed buildings recognised for their heritage value.

What restrictions apply in Mapleton?
Properties in Mapleton Conservation Area may face restrictions on demolition, tree work (6 weeks' notice required), and certain exterior alterations. Contact your local planning authority for specific rules that apply here.
